Tulip Festivals Kick Off Across North America

News summary

Tulip festivals across North America are underway, each celebrating the vibrant spring bloom with unique traditions and activities. In Orange City, Iowa, organizers meticulously plan a year in advance, importing 30,000 bulbs from the Netherlands and relying on volunteers to ensure the tulips bloom perfectly for their three-day festival. Meanwhile, Pingle’s Farm in Ontario is debuting its Tulip Days, featuring over 500,000 blooms, pick-your-own bouquets, and family-friendly attractions such as wagon rides, live music, and local food, although unseasonably cold weather delayed the festival’s start. Both events highlight the importance of precise timing and community involvement to create memorable floral experiences. The festivals not only showcase the beauty of tulips but also offer a variety of activities that appeal to visitors of all ages.
